U-operators
Inspired by a statement of W. Luh asserting the existence of entire functions having together with all their derivatives and antiderivatives
some kind of additive universality or multiplicative universality on certain compact subsets of the complex plane or of, respectively, the punctured complex plane, we introduce in this paper the new concept of U-operators, which are defined on the space of entire functions. Concrete examples, including differential and antidifferential operators, composition, multiplication and shift operators, are studied. Sequences of differential operators: exponentials, hypercyclicity and equicontinuity
In this paper, an eigenvalue criterion for hypercyclicity due to the first author is improved. As a consequence, some new sufficient conditions for a sequence of infinite order linear differential operators to be hypercyclic on the space of holomorphic functions on certain domains of C N are shown. Moreover, several necessary conditions are furnished. The equicontinuity of a family of operators as before is also studied, and it is even characterized if the domain is C N. Towards Accurate Modeling of Line-Intensity Mapping One-Point Statistics: Including Extended Profiles
Line-intensity mapping (LIM) is quickly attracting attention as an
alternative technique to probe large-scale structure and galaxy formation and
evolution at high redshift. LIM one-point statistics are motivated because they
provide access to the highly non-Gaussian information present in line-intensity
maps and contribute to break degeneracies between cosmology and astrophysics.
Now that promising surveys are underway, an accurate model for the LIM
probability distribution function (PDF) is necessary to employ one-point
statistics. We consider the impact of extended emission and limited
experimental resolution in the LIM PDF for the first time. We find that these
effects result in a lower and broader peak at low intensities and a lower tail
towards high intensities. Focusing on the distribution of intensities in the
observed map, we perform the first model validation of LIM one-point statistics
with simulations and find good qualitative agreement. We also discuss the
impact on the covariance, and demonstrate that if not accounted for, large
biases in the astrophysical parameters can be expected in parameter inference.
These effects are also relevant for any summary statistic estimated from the
LIM PDF, and must be implemented to avoid biased results. The comparison with
simulations shows, however, that there are still deviations, mostly related
with the modeling of the clustering of emitters, which encourage further

Cosmological implications of Primordial Black Holes
The possibility that a relevant fraction of the dark matter might be
comprised of Primordial Black Holes (PBHs) has been seriously reconsidered
after LIGO's detection of a binary black holes merger.
Despite the strong interest in the model, there is a lack of studies on
possible cosmological implications and effects on cosmological parameters
inference. We investigate correlations with the other standard cosmological
parameters using cosmic microwave background observations, finding significant
degeneracies, especially with the tilt of the primordial power spectrum and the
sound horizon at radiation drag. However, these degeneracies can be greatly
reduced with the inclusion of small scale polarization data. We also explore if
PBHs as dark matter in simple extensions of the standard CDM
cosmological model induces extra degeneracies, especially between the
additional parameters and the PBH's ones. Finally, we present cosmic microwave
background constraints on the fraction of dark matter in PBHs, not only for
monochromatic PBH mass distributions but also for popular extended mass
distributions. Our results show that extended mass distribution's constraints
are tighter, but also that a considerable amount of constraining power comes
from the high- polarization data. Moreover, we constrain the shape of
such mass distributions in terms of the correspondent constraints on the PBH

La revista "Ultra" de Oviedo en el mar revuelto del ultra
Ultra de Oviedo es una interesante y desconocida revista literaria. Debido a su rareza bibliográfica apenas ha tenido referencias críticas y las pocas, no son muy exhaustivas. Tal vez jugó un papel crucial entre las experiencias regionalistas de la España de vanguardia en el primer período de posguerra y llegó a ser bastión periférico del “Ultraísmo” que brotó en Sevilla y se desarrolló más tarde en Madrid. La revista canalizó los trabajos de vanguardia de sus creadores y también incluye entre sus páginas algunos de los más relevantes poetas de la nueva generación literaria ligada al ultraísmo con nombres como Isaac de Vando Villar, Adriano del Valle, Guillermo de Torre y Gerardo Diego.Ultra from Oviedo is an interesting, almost unknown, literary magazine. Due
to its bibliographical rarity it has hardly had critical references, and the very few are not very exhaustive. However, it played a crucial role within the regionalist experiences of the Spanish vanguard in the early years of the postwar
period. It became a committed peripheral bastion of the «Ultraísmo», which sprang up in Sevilla and later developed in Madrid. Ultra from Oviedo not only channeled the supposedly vanguard works of its creators, not very well known in national
literary panorama, but it also included in its pages some of the most relevant poets
of the new literary generation, who were linked to «Ultraísmo». Names such as
Isaac de Vando Villar, Adriano del Valle, Guillermo de Torre and Gerardo Diego
